The Ultimate Guide to the Beige Caterpillar: Identification, Life Cycle & Care

The beige caterpillar represents a fascinating intersection of natural camouflage and survival strategy within diverse ecosystems. Often overlooked against the backdrop of dried grasses and sandy soils, this particular color morph plays a critical role in the food chain. Its subtle palette allows it to evade predators while feeding on a variety of host plants. Understanding this creature reveals the intricate balance maintained within natural habitats.

Physical Characteristics and Identification

Identifying this insect relies heavily on its distinctive coloration and body structure. Unlike its vividly colored relatives, the beige variant blends seamlessly with its environment. This cryptic appearance is the primary defense mechanism utilized throughout its larval stage. The body is typically cylindrical and covered in fine, short setae that aid in texture matching.

Specific physical markers include:

A uniform tan or light brown body tone.

Minimal patterning, often limited to subtle dorsal stripes.

Prolegs adapted for secure gripping on stems and leaves.

Antennae capable of detecting chemical cues from host plants.

Habitat and Geographic Distribution

These caterpillars demonstrate a remarkable adaptability to varying climates, though they are most prevalent in temperate regions. They are frequently observed in meadows, agricultural fields, and disturbed soils where their food sources are abundant. The ability to thrive in human-modified landscapes highlights their resilience. They are found across multiple continents, indicating a successful evolutionary history.

Key environmental preferences include:

Areas with moderate humidity and sunlight exposure.

Regions containing specific larval host plants.

Soil types that facilitate easy burrowing during pupation.

Host Plants and Feeding Behavior

The dietary habits of the beige caterpillar are central to its existence and impact on the ecosystem. Larvae are generally polyphagous, feeding on a wide range of herbaceous plants. This feeding behavior, while necessary for growth, can sometimes place them in conflict with agricultural interests. They utilize powerful mandibles to chew through leaf tissue, consuming substantial amounts of foliage.

Common host plants include:

Plant Family
Example Species
Fabaceae
Various clovers and vetches
Poaceae
Grasses and cereal crops
Malvaceae
Mallow and related weeds

Life Cycle and Metamorphosis

Observing the life cycle of this insect provides insight into the complexities of complete metamorphosis. The journey from egg to adult involves several distinct stages, each with specific objectives for survival. The caterpillar phase is dedicated primarily to rapid growth and energy storage. This stage is followed by the formation of a pupa, where the dramatic transformation into an adult occurs.

The stages are generally as follows:

Egg: Laid on host plant surfaces.

First Instar: Emerges and begins immediate feeding.

Pupation: Encases itself in a protective cocoon or underground chamber.

Adult: Emerges as a moth or butterfly to reproduce.

Ecological Significance

Beyond their role as herbivores, these insects serve as a vital food source for numerous predators. Birds, spiders, and parasitic wasps rely on the caterpillar stage for sustenance. This positions them as a key component of energy transfer within food webs. Their presence indicates a healthy, functioning ecosystem with biodiversity.
